This large parking area under the Walberla is a quiet base for hiking, with views toward the valley and mountain. Most spaces are slightly sloped, and there is no electricity, drinking water or chemical toilet. A free toilet, Kneipp facility, walking and cycling paths, and a small honesty-pay fruit stand are nearby.
